Round the Island Cruise

1st September 2021

Round The Island Cruise 1st September 2021

This is not a race! It's a sailing-in-company event for HYC so it's a little different to our normal rallies. Sailing boats are invited to join us as we try to sail right round The Isle Of Wight in a day. With HW Portsmouth being at 07:05 BST on 1st September the conditions should be very similar to the RTIR earlier this year but this is not a race. Instead, sailors are invited to join us at the start, an imaginary line between Gilkicker Point and Ryde Spire, at 06:00 and keep a note of their own times and progress. This early start should allow us all to get past The Needles before the tide turns. Sailing skippers are encouraged to invite the motor boaters onto their boats to increase the fun. Motor boaters who choose not to join the "rag and stick" bunch may choose to come out and keep us company and puzzle over just why we do it! Evening dinner will be on the Lightship at Haslar to compare notes and claim bragging rights but of course this is not a race!

A lead boat will be available to help and advise. We will be using VHF Channel 77 as an inter-club frequency for the weekend although monitoring on Ch11 (Portsmouth Harbour) and Ch 12 (Southampton VTS) as appropriate together with Channel 16 is advised.

It's a different sort of event for HYC members and should appeal to those who would like to sail around the Island in a day but without the pressure of doing it with thousands of other vessels.

Did we mention: it's not a race!
